KUALA LUMPUR: Some 7,000 public safety officials from various agencies, including the police, will be on the ground throughout the SEA Games, said Comm Datuk Amar Singh.
The city police chief said the officials would be tasked to monitor and control public safety in and around sports venues and accommodation areas throughout the 12-day event, which starts on Aug 19.
